Altova FlowForce Server 2024 Advanced Edition

Erstellt eine Datei, wenn die Quelle des Stream eine Datei ist. Erstellt eine temporäre Datei, wenn die Quelle des Stream keine Datei ist.

 

Signatur

as-file(stream:stream) -> string

 

Parameter

Name

Typ

Beschreibung

stream

stream

Definiert die Quelle des Stream.

 

Beispiele

Der folgende Auftrag erstellt eine Datei namens file.txt mit einer Textzeile. Zuerst wird mit der Funktion stream-from-string ein Stream anhand des als Argument bereitgestellten Texts generiert. Als nächstes erhält die Funktion as-file den Stream als Argument und generiert anhand dessen eine temporäre Datei. Um die temporäre Datei in einen permanenten Pfad zu kopieren, wird die vordefinierte Funktion copy über einen separaten Ausführungsschritt aufgerufen. Die Datei wird in das Arbeitsverzeichnis des Auftrags (C:\FlowForce) kopiert und bei jeder Auftragsausführung überschrieben.

fs_func-example-as-file

Siehe auch Validieren eines XML-Dokuments mit Fehlerprotokollierung.

© 2017-2023 Altova GmbH